How to Achieve Your Goals, Fourth Edition How can you get motivated? Make a commitment – State your commitment concretely – Take the first step – Stay aware of each commitment – Keep an eye on your progress – Reward yourself as you move ahead Page 11

How to Achieve Your Goals, Fourth Edition How can you get motivated? Develop positive habits – Define and evaluate the habit – Decide to keep or change the habit – Start today - and keep it up – Reward positive steps Page 11

How to Achieve Your Goals, Fourth Edition How can you get motivated? Face your fears – Acknowledge fears – Examine fears – Develop a plan of attack – Move ahead with your plan Page 11

How to Achieve Your Goals, Fourth Edition What is the connection between college and lifelong learning? College prepares you to learn from failure and celebrate success – Learning from failure Look at what happened Make any possible improvements on the situation Stay aware of the fact that you are a capable, valuable person Share your thoughts and disappointments with others Look on the bright side Page 21
